New Delhi: The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) on Monday knocked on the door of the Election Commission against remarks made by former Congress president on ‘sovereignty of Karnataka’.

Karnataka Polls: BJP Moves EC, Seeks Immediate Action Against Congress, Sonia Gandhi Over ‘Sovereignty Remark’

The remark has triggered a massive political storm in the run-up to the Karnataka assembly election, scheduled to be held on May 10. Reports said that a delegation of the BJP went to the poll panel office in the national capital. “She (Sonia Gandhi) deliberately used the word sovereignty. Congress manifesto is the agenda of the ‘Tukde-Tukde’ gang and hence they are using such words. MiG 21 Aircraft Crashes In Rajasthan, 3 Civilians Dead; Pilot Escapes Unhurt

Three civilians, including two women, lost their lives while one other was injured after an Indian Airforce aircraft MiG 21 crashed near Hanumangarh in Rajasthan on Monday. The pilot of the aircraft managed to escape unhurt. The pilot is safe and the army’s helicopter has reached the accident site for rescue, ANI reported citing sources. Weather Update: Low-Pressure Area Formed Over Southeast Bay Of Bengal Likely to Intensify Into Depression On May 9

A low-pressure area has formed over the Southeast Bay of Bengal and the adjoining South Andaman Sea. According to the India Meteorological Department (IMD), the cyclonic storm is likely to intensify into a depression on May 9 and further into a cyclonic storm over the southeast Bay of Bengal and adjoining areas of East Central Bay of Bengal and the Andaman Sea on May 10. Handshake Gone Wrong! Arijit Singh Gets Injured After Excited Fan Pulls His Hand At Aurangabad Concert

Popular singer Arijit Singh got injured during his Aurangad concert when an excited fan pulled his hand to shake hands with him. Unfortunately, Arijit lost his balance and injured his hand. Notably, he didn’t lose his cool and tried to make the person realise his mistake. He was heard saying, “Why did you pull my hand? See, now I can’t even move my hand. It’s a simple equation. If I can’t perform, how will the show continue? I want to interact with all my fans, and I have immense love for all of you. Asia Cup 2023: Sri Lanka, Bangladesh Side With BCCI, Corner Pakistan Over Hosting Continental Event – Report

Sri Lanka and Bangladesh have reportedly backed the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) and are in favour of shifting the tournament away from Pakistan. The Asian Cricket Council are likely to invite United Arab Emirates (UAE) as a replacement for the Men in Green if they refuse to participate in the tournament if it is shifted to a neutral location.
